Robin Jones Gunn
Robin Jones Gunn is the much-loved author of seventy titles that have sold more than four million copies worldwide. Her popular Christy Miller series and Sisterchicks® novels have won a number of awards, including three Christy Awards for excellence in fiction, and a Gold Medallion Award finalist award. Robin's unique destination novels transport readers around the globe. To ensure that her tales of these extraordinary locations ring true, Robin has enjoyed the privilege of traveling to each location in order to experience the local culture. Her three visits to the Canary Islands provided bountiful research as she took flamenco dance lessons, rode a camel, and visited the chapel where Columbus prayed before departing on his famous journey. Robin and her husband have two grown children and live in Hawaii.

- Rating: 3 out of 5 stars3/5I've read the Christy/Todd series and the Sierra Jensen series as well as the first book of this series, though this was many years ago. I applaud Gunn for trying to show how romantic love should be according to Christ's precepts (no sex before marriage, not kissing every guy/girl you go out with, avoiding temptations etc.) but her concept of having the girl not sure if they're really a couple is getting old.It seems Katie has wanted to be Rick's girlfriend for a long time. Yet to me, both Rick and Katie are sending some mixed signals. Katie claims Rick is her boyfriend, but she also claims to relate more to Eli's way of life than she does to Rick's. Rick at times acts like Katie's his girlfriend, but he also seems to be a bit flirty with Nicole. Leaving me to wonder if the two of them will make it through the series.I liked the interaction between Eli and Joseph and the stories about living in Africa. I felt sad for Joseph that he'd left his wife and daughter behind when he was chosen to pursue and education in the US. (Apparently something happened with their paperwork that prevented them from joining him.)Katie does seem to fly off the handle a lot, particularly if she feels someone is criticizing her. It seemed like she fought with most people in the book, except maybe for Eli and Joseph. Something she's going to have to work on as she matures.
- Rating: 5 out of 5 stars5/5Katie Wheldon is now in her senior year of college and she thinks she has everything planned out. She especially thinks she's ready to take her relationship with Rick to become more serious. Rick is ready too but his work schedule works havoc into making their intentions happen. So Katie steps back and lets things go more slowly. However after a midnight trip into the desert to do some star watching with Rick's roommate and events like Baby Hummer dying, Katie becomes confused about how her future should be planned out.Reading about Katie Weldon is like reading the story about one of your close friends. I grew up reading the Christy Miller and Sierra Jensen series so reading Katie's books is a must. I definitely miss being an undergrad student living in the dorms when I read this book. Dorm life is something everyone should experience. The adventures Katie has in the dorms just bring back a lot of memories. I loved the whole flower mystery. I was kind of worried about the way Katie and Eli's relationship was going. I don't want anything to compromise her relationship with Rick. The trip out to the desert, while breathtaking, did have grounds for concern from Christy and others. While totally innocent, I could see why eyebrows might have been raised especially at a Christian college. I do love reading about her and Rick's relationship. It's great to see Rick evolve from the high school jock who tried to get Christy to this really nice grown up guy who cares very much about Katie. I just do not understand Katie's mother. It seems that no matter what Katie does, she cannot please her. I would go absolutely berserk if she was my mom, but Katie handles her very well. She would be an interesting mother in law for whoever marries Katie. The whole story is just something almost every 20-something goes through. I, myself, could totally relate with Katie throughout her choice, decisions and feelings. I get excited every time I read a Robin Jones Gunn book because I know it will be a good read. I really love the characters she's created and I hope she'll never stop writing about them. I cannot until book 3 comes out!
